Public Relations: Competencies and Practice focuses on the required competencies expected of public relations into specific sectors of practice. The book offers students competency and practice focused content from top PR experts and incorporates interviews from professionals to show students how to apply competencies.
The industry of public relations is rapidly evolving, requiring practitioners to have greater specialisation than ever before. Hand in hand with the growth of the industry, educational programmes have developed to address the growing need for quality preparation for future practitioners. Public Relations: Competencies and Practice focuses on the required competencies expected and applications of public relations into specific sectors of practice.
Based on competencies identified by organisations such as the Commission on Public Relations Education and the Public Relations Society of America, Public Relations provides a robust examination of areas such as diversity, leadership, and ethics. The second part of the text focuses on these unique requirements for undergraduate and graduate students focused on entering sectors such as entertainment public relations, nonprofit public relations, or investor relations.

David Remund, Ph.D., APR, Fellow PRSA, praised the book in the Journal of Public Relations Education, highlighting its "important insights and actionable ideas for the individual practitioner." He noted its consistent framework, rich content, and accessibility for undergraduate students and emerging professionals. The book includes useful teaching resources such as sample syllabi, discussion questions, and project suggestions. Additionally, it was ranked among the best new PR books to read in 2020 by BookAuthority.

About the Author
Carolyn Mae Kim is anΒ Associate Professor of Public Relations at Biola University. Her research specialties include credibility, digital strategy, media ecology, and public relations education.
